Core Insights - The "Green Intelligence Future" Global Sustainability Challenge concluded in Shenzhen, focusing on innovative green technology projects to support global sustainable development goals [1][3] - The event highlighted China's leadership in green transformation and the importance of international collaboration to address climate change [1][2] Group 1: Event Overview - The challenge was co-hosted by Xiangfeng Investment China Fund and Temasek Foundation, aiming to discover advanced and commercially viable projects in the green technology sector [1] - Over 1,000 green technology solutions from more than 70 countries and regions participated, with 10 projects reaching the finals [3] Group 2: Key Themes and Discussions - Experts emphasized the role of charitable capital as "patient" and "catalytic" to bridge the investment gap in climate industries, advocating for technology sharing and capital linkage between China and Singapore [2] - The integration of technology and industry innovation was discussed, focusing on enhancing high-quality tech supply and the transformation of scientific achievements [2] Group 3: Award Winners and Innovations - The Tianjin Feiman Power Technology Co., Ltd. won the Excellence Award, while Shenzhen Daotong New Energy Co., Ltd., ROTOBOOST, and Shenzhen Zhonghe Energy Storage Technology Co., Ltd. received Elite Awards for their breakthroughs in CO resource utilization, battery regeneration, emission reduction in the steel industry, and long-duration energy storage technology [3] - The challenge marked Temasek Foundation's first extension of green-related competitions to China, recognizing the country's vast entrepreneurial ecosystem and strong green technology innovation capabilities [3] Group 4: Future Outlook - Xiangfeng Investment remains committed to long-term investments in the green sector, despite lower exit activity compared to TMT and consumer sectors, believing in the long-term social and commercial value of green initiatives [3]
